ExcelHome技术论坛

 找回密码
 免费注册

QQ登录

只需一步,快速开始

快捷登录

搜索
EH技术汇-专业的职场技能充电站 妙哉!函数段子手趣味讲函数 Excel服务器-会Excel,做管理系统 Excel Home精品图文教程库
HR薪酬管理数字化实战 Excel 2021函数公式学习大典 Excel数据透视表实战秘技 打造核心竞争力的职场宝典
300集Office 2010微视频教程 数据工作者的案头书 免费直播课集锦 ExcelHome出品 - VBA代码宝免费下载
用ChatGPT与VBA一键搞定Excel WPS表格从入门到精通 Excel VBA经典代码实践指南
查看: 3898|回复: 11

[已解决] 请教一个利用 名称管理器 使用 EVALUATE 的问题

[复制链接]

TA的精华主题

TA的得分主题

发表于 2020-3-16 09:06 | 显示全部楼层 |阅读模式
本帖最后由 fsl185 于 2020-3-16 10:35 编辑

各位版主、大侠:
      小白请教一个请教一个利用 名称管理器 使用 EVALUATE 的问题,在附件的表格中,计算后的结果返回#value!,不知道问题出在哪里,请大家帮忙看看。

      表格思路如下:
      明细 sheet页 用来存 VLOOKUP索引指向、定义名称 及 名称定义需要用到的参数
     

返回vlookup并计算

返回vlookup并计算

                                VLOOKUP sheet页 用来存 不同的计算公式
                                

vlookup的索引目标

vlookup的索引目标

     表格中的公式
     

表格中的公式

表格中的公式

     名称定义如下
      

Pole极数定义

Pole极数定义
   
      

计算定义

计算定义


     最后求值计算
     

      但是返回的结果不正确,出现了#value!
      请各位帮着看看问题出在哪里?
      谢谢大家了!

       示例.zip (7.09 KB, 下载次数: 3)

TA的精华主题

TA的得分主题

发表于 2020-3-16 09:17 | 显示全部楼层
定义名称的公式能截图就好了

TA的精华主题

TA的得分主题

发表于 2020-3-16 09:22 | 显示全部楼层

TA的精华主题

TA的得分主题

 楼主| 发表于 2020-3-16 09:33 | 显示全部楼层
hlq10 发表于 2020-3-16 09:22
名称定义Pole极数要B2开始

正解
不过不太明白,像原来那样,定义为B列为什么会出错?

TA的精华主题

TA的得分主题

发表于 2020-3-16 09:34 | 显示全部楼层
本帖最后由 丢丢表格 于 2020-3-16 09:38 编辑
hlq10 发表于 2020-3-16 09:22
名称定义Pole极数要B2开始

这样的定义名称, 就是从 B6666666  开始也没用。  规则就不对!!
比如叫你做去做饭,结果你爬到大树上去抓鱼
风马牛的事

反正看不懂楼主的意图

TA的精华主题

TA的得分主题

发表于 2020-3-16 09:50 | 显示全部楼层
从哪学来的那么多整列引用啊,你的目的是自动计算什么?B列的值*50吗?那没必要定义名称,直接写公式可以吧

TA的精华主题

TA的得分主题

 楼主| 发表于 2020-3-16 09:54 | 显示全部楼层
好像在单元格里好像可以这么写呀,为什么在定义名称里就不可以?

TA的精华主题

TA的得分主题

 楼主| 发表于 2020-3-16 10:06 | 显示全部楼层
micch 发表于 2020-3-16 09:50
从哪学来的那么多整列引用啊,你的目的是自动计算什么?B列的值*50吗?那没必要定义名称,直接写公式可以吧

留一行是为了方便表述,VLOOKUP sheet页里有几十条规则,明细表里大概有几百条规则,真正的表格要复杂得多。在做一个模板,卡在这个环节了。

TA的精华主题

TA的得分主题

发表于 2020-3-16 10:08 | 显示全部楼层
那就把整列引用改单元格引用吧,注意相对引用就行

TA的精华主题

TA的得分主题

 楼主| 发表于 2020-3-16 10:11 | 显示全部楼层
[广告] Excel易用宝 - 提升Excel的操作效率 · Excel / WPS表格插件       ★免费下载 ★       ★ 使用帮助
丢丢表格 发表于 2020-3-16 09:34
这样的定义名称, 就是从 B6666666  开始也没用。  规则就不对!!
比如叫你做去做饭,结果你爬到大树上 ...

做数据字典
VLOOKUP 是 规则和公式
明细表     是 参数
明细表里 有一列是关键字 然后一堆列 列里存各种参数 然后根据关键字在VLOOKUP表里取规则和公式 最后拿回来计算结果
您需要登录后才可以回帖 登录 | 免费注册

本版积分规则

关闭

最新热点上一条 /1 下一条

手机版|关于我们|联系我们|ExcelHome

GMT+8, 2024-4-20 16:28 , Processed in 0.045939 second(s), 12 queries , Gzip On, MemCache On.

Powered by Discuz! X3.4

© 1999-2023 Wooffice Inc.

沪公网安备 31011702000001号 沪ICP备11019229号-2

本论坛言论纯属发表者个人意见,任何违反国家相关法律的言论,本站将协助国家相关部门追究发言者责任!     本站特聘法律顾问:李志群律师

快速回复 返回顶部 返回列表